MOBILE MONEY LIMITED LAUNCHES ‘BIVAMOMOTIMA 3’ TO REWARD MERCHANTS AND PROMOTE CASHLESS TRANSACTIONS

Mobile Money Limited has officially launched the third edition of its popular ‘BivaMoMotima’ campaign, this time focusing on rewarding merchants who actively use MoMoPay for transactions. The campaign, which starts today, will incentivize merchants who receive payments from customers through their MoMoPay codes and make payments to other merchants using the service. As a grand prize, two lucky merchants will each win a pickup truck.

Speaking at the launch, Chantal Kagame, CEO of Mobile Money Limited, emphasized the significance of the campaign in promoting digital transactions and financial inclusion. “We are proud to launch this campaign as we celebrate a major milestone—reaching 500,000 merchants last year. We had a total of 3.3 million users of MoMoPay services actively paying these merchants, which aligns with the government’s strategy to drive a cashless economy. This achievement reflects the trust that businesses across Rwanda have placed in Mobile Money as a reliable payment solution. ‘BivaMoMotima 3’ is our way of thanking them and encouraging more merchants to join the MoMoPay network for seamless, secure, and efficient transactions,” she said.

The ‘BivaMoMotima’ campaign has been instrumental in Mobile Money Limited’s broader mission to advance digital financial inclusion. This third edition builds on the success of previous campaigns by specifically recognizing and rewarding merchants, who are essential in strengthening the cashless payment ecosystem in Rwanda.

MoMoPay provides merchants with a convenient and secure alternative to cash transactions, allowing them to receive payments through a dedicated USSD code. With over half a million merchants already registered, Mobile Money Limited aims to expand its network by encouraging more businesses to embrace digital payments for improved efficiency and security.
